A good security video camera system doesn't start with boxes on a rack. It starts with a brief workout in risk, layout, and practices. I discovered that early while helping a small production customer that kept having copper spool vanish on weekends. They had 8 cams already, but ip camera installation services none caught the loading dock. When we mapped real motion patterns and light conditions, we resolved the issue with 3 cams and better placement. Gear matters, however the plan matters more.
This guide walks through the decisions that really shape outcomes: where to place eyes, how to power them, what bandwidth you can spare, and how to keep video searchable and acceptable. If you end up calling an expert for cctv installation services, you will understand precisely what to request and why. If you do it yourself, you will prevent the traps that cost time and leave blind spots.
Think in terms of events you want to catch. A patio pirate at five feet is various from a trespasser at thirty. License plates require more resolution than faces at the same range, particularly in the evening. Retail diminish is an aisle problem, not a door issue. The images you require dictate your choice between wide coverage and detail.
Walk your home at the hours that worry you. Notification shadows, streetlights, glare, and reflective surface areas. If you can, hold your phone video camera at the installing height and take sample shots day and night. Your eye will lie about brightness and angles. Images will not. Procedure distances with a tape or a laser measure, and note the paths people actually take, not the routes you want they would. For outside locations, mark the dominant wind instructions and where rain blows in. Water on a dome turns deals with into ghosts.
A quick, real-world example: a dining establishment with theft in the parking area had 2 8 mm electronic cameras pointed at the entrance. They looked excellent in daytime. In the evening, every plate was a white flare. We switched one electronic camera for a varifocal lens positioned at a shallow angle off the lot's main lane and included a low-glare flood to level lighting. Plate reads went from nearly none to roughly 70 percent, even on rainy nights.
Wireless security cams solve one issue and produce 2 others. They free you from running video cable television, however they require stable power and tidy radio conditions. If you can run Ethernet, a wired IP video camera installation is still the most foreseeable choice. For older structures where fishing cable television is a problem, carefully planned wireless nodes can work well.
Use wired when the cam is vital, the environment is thick with Wi‑Fi devices, or the structure enables cabling without significant disturbance. Power over Ethernet is the workhorse here. A single Cat6 cable television supplies both power and information, streamlines surge defense, and scales cleanly to dozens of devices. If the run surpasses 100 meters, add a PoE switch mid-run or fiber with a media converter.
Use wireless when the only useful concern is power and you trust your radio environment. Battery-powered electronic cameras are hassle-free for low-traffic spots or temporary coverage. Anticipate to alter or charge batteries every few weeks in busy locations, and more frequently in winter. For irreversible wireless, aim for line-of-sight point-to-point links if the cam rests on a separated structure. For suburban homes, Wi‑Fi mesh with a devoted backhaul can keep feeds stable, however test throughput with the electronic camera's bitrate before you mount anything. A cam streaming at 4 Mbps is great on paper till four of them saturate your 2.4 GHz band.
Hybrid setups prevail. Wire the top priority electronic cameras, and utilize cordless security electronic cameras to cover minimal locations where running cable television would imply ripping drywall. That mix lowers cost and speeds deployment without compromising reliability.
Resolution offers electronic cameras, however lens options and placement win cases. A 4K sensing unit with a broad 2.8 mm lens will provide broad coverage and poor detail at distance. A 4 MP sensor with a 6 mm lens might check out a face at 30 feet. The majority of sites benefit from a mix: a wide cam for situational awareness and a tighter lens for recognition at choke points.
Varifocal lenses, normally 2.8 to 12 mm, let you fine-tune framing throughout installation. Repaired lenses are more affordable and work when you know the distance and angle ahead of time. Motorized varifocal designs help when you can not access the mount quickly after the fact. For long driveways, think about 8 to 32 mm varifocal or committed LPR (license plate recognition) electronic cameras that handle shutter speed and IR differently to freeze plates at speed.
Sensor size and low-light performance matter as much as pixel count. Larger sensing units with lower f‑number lenses collect more light, reduce noise, and keep IR reflection workable. Check the vendor's minimum illumination in lux, but take it with a grain of salt. Real scenes are unpleasant. If your target location is regularly listed below 5 lux, either install supplemental lighting or choose a camera with strong built-in IR and great IR cut filters. Avoid pointing IR domes straight at reflective surface areas like gloss paint or white vinyl siding. The halo will wreck your night image.


Domes look discreet and resist tampering, but the bubble can collect grime or dew, particularly under soffits where air stagnates. Bullets shed water, run cooler, and usually have much better incorporated IR throw, however they are easier to grab. Turrets divided the distinction and are popular for their tidy IR habits. PTZ cameras have their location, usually in backyards or lots where you need to guide to examine. Do not expect a PTZ to be pointing at the ideal location when you really need it unless you automate trips and triggers. Repaired cameras are the backbone; PTZ fills in.
Mounting height modifications outcomes. High mounts reduce vandalism and widen protection, however they hurt face capture. If you need identification, anchor at roughly 8 to 10 feet over a doorway and cant the video camera so a person's face fills a minimum of 15 percent of the frame at the target range. Usage junction boxes that match the electronic camera base to prevent cramming connections inside soffits. Seal penetrations with exterior-rated silicone, however leave a drip loop in your cable television so water does not wick into the wall.
Indoors, prevent aiming across windows. Even with WDR, an intense afternoon will burn out detail. Aim along the window wall or utilize shades. In kitchen areas and humid areas, use housings rated for steam and splatter. In warehouses, vibration can slowly stroll a camera off target; thread-locker on set screws and stiff installs save headaches.
Surveillance traffic is foreseeable if you prepare. Spending plan bitrate before you purchase. A normal 4 MP H. 265 stream can run in between 2 and 6 Mbps depending on scene complexity and motion. Multiply by electronic camera count, then add 30 percent buffer. If your switch uplink is 1 Gbps and you plan for 32 electronic cameras at 4 Mbps each, you are near the comfort limit as soon as you consist of bursts, management overhead, and remote watching. Usage stacked or aggregated uplinks, and avoid daisy-chaining low-cost unmanaged switches like Christmas lights.
A devoted VLAN for electronic cameras and the recorder does 3 things: it restricts broadcast noise, streamlines QoS, and enhances security. Offer the NVR and video cameras static or DHCP-reserved addresses. Keep the video camera management interface behind a firewall program and need strong, special qualifications. Disable UPnP on routers and never ever expose an NVR to the internet straight. If you want remote gain access to, use a VPN or a vendor app with two-factor authentication.
For cordless sections, run a site survey throughout the busiest time of day. Channels might look tidy at twelve noon and collapse at 7 pm when neighbors stream. Favor 5 GHz for cams if variety allows, and anchor cameras on SSIDs with low contention. If a cam's signal drops below about -70 dBm RSSI throughout tests, either move the access point or add a dedicated bridge.
Footage you can not retrieve is sound. Start with a retention target. Residences typically keep 7 to 14 days. Small businesses range from 14 to 30. Websites with compliance requirements might mandate 60 days or more. Motion-based recording extends storage, however don't overstate savings. Hectic scenes still chew through disk.
For on-premises recording, NVRs with enterprise-grade drives are worth the small premium. Surveillance-class disks best security camera installations in Pittsburgh handle continuous composes and greater operating temperature levels. RAID 5 or 6 purchases uptime but not backup. If a camera records a critical event, export it immediately and archive to a separate gadget or cloud in a write-once format. Note time offsets if the system clock drifts. I have actually seen cases break down because the video timestamp was 4 minutes off the point-of-sale data.
Cloud storage eases management however watch recurring costs and upload bandwidth. A single 4 MP camera at 2 Mbps running continuously presses roughly 21 GB daily. 4 electronic cameras will strike 80 to 90 GB daily. The majority of property uplinks can not sustain that. Hybrid methods cache locally and press motion occasions or time-lapse photos to the cloud. That gives off-site strength without choking the line.
Analytics can decrease sound and make searches bearable. Fundamental motion detection triggers whenever a branch waves. Modern cams with onboard AI models identify people, lorries, and sometimes animals. Line crossing, intrusion boxes, and loitering detection get rid of much of the junk. Heat maps aid in retail to understand traffic, though they are more tactical than security-focused.

Be skeptical of checkbox functions. Individual detection at midday is easy. Person detection at night, in rain, with IR flowering, is where designs stumble. If you care about plate capture, utilize dedicated LPR streams with quick shutter and IR tuned for retroreflective sheeting. For anti-tailgating in lobbies, set an electronic camera with a gain access to control system and an easy rule: door open time versus single credential. The most reputable notifies are those tied to physical occasions, not just pixels moving.
Voice and light deterrence can be effective when they are immediate and particular. A camera that plays a generic message after a 10-second hold-up teaches trespassers to overlook it. A light that snaps on at the edge of a yard when somebody enters a specified zone is better. Incorporate with existing lighting where possible. Consistent illumination not only enhances quick security camera installations video however likewise alters behavior.
Plenty of property owners and small shops do an exceptional job with do it yourself security electronic camera installation. The trade-offs boil down to time, tools, and threat tolerance. A pro will bring cable fish tools, correct termination gear, a PoE tester, and typically a lift for safe installing. More vital, they bring a pattern memory of what has actually failed previously. They understand which soffits hide spaces that swallow noise and trap humidity, or which stucco composition needs unique anchors.
If you bring in cctv installation services, request a recorded monitoring system setup: a map with field of visions, lens choices, PoE budgets, switch and NVR designs, VLAN strategy, retention mathematics, and a password handoff procedure. Need that admin accounts be moved to you which default passwords be altered. Request a test walk with exports from each camera, day and night, and verify time sync with NTP. These little steps prevent the common trap of a system that looks fine until the one night you need it.
Pre-plan: sketch camera positions on a scaled strategy, note heights, cable paths, and PoE endpoints. Measure ranges and verify that each run is under 100 meters or that a mid-span switch is planned. Choose retention and calculate storage with a 30 percent buffer.
Bench setup: upgrade firmware on the NVR and cameras before mounting. Appoint addresses, set a calling convention that explains place and lens (for example, "FrontDoor_2.8 mm"). Enable HTTPS and disable unnecessary services. Include the electronic cameras to the NVR and confirm streams.
Cable and power: pull Cat6, prevent tight staples, and keep parallel perform at least a foot from high-voltage lines. Usage keystone jacks or shielded ports where appropriate. Label both ends. Test each kept up a cable television tester and a PoE load tester.
Mount and goal: temporarily tape or clamp cams in place while you check framing on a live view. Adjust for daytime and night, then tighten up mounts. Seal outside penetrations and produce drip loops.
Tune and file: set bitrate, frame rate, and GOP. Enable movement or analytic guidelines with sensitivity checked throughout day-night transitions. Set NTP, user accounts, and retention. Export a test clip from each cam and conserve a final map with settings.
This sequence is not glamorous, but it saves hours of callbacks. Shortcuts typically show up later on as choppy video, dropped streams, or storage that fills too early.
Cheap cable television costs more in the long run. Usage solid copper Cat6 from a reputable brand. CCA (copper-clad aluminum) might pass a fundamental connection test however drops voltage on long terms and warms under load. For outside runs, use UV-rated coat and drip loops. Where lightning is an issue, include PoE surge protectors at the building entry and bond them to a proper ground.
For remote buildings, wireless bridges work well, however think about fiber if you can trench. Fiber shakes off lightning-induced surges that kill copper. Media converters and little SFP switches are economical compared with replacing fried gear. In farms and marinas, this spends for itself the first storm.
Battery-powered models gain from practical responsibility cycle mathematics. A camera that declares three months of life frequently presumes 10 events per day at brief clips. Put that very same video camera on a hectic alley and you will be recharging every week. Photovoltaic panel work when they get unshaded sun for a minimum of four to 6 hours daily and when the website's winter angle is represented. Mount panels where ladders are safe and theft is difficult.
Security cameras record more than your own property. Laws differ by state and country, however a couple of standards take a trip well. Do not intend into bedrooms or private interior spaces of surrounding homes. If you have audio recording enabled, know that two-party permission laws might apply. In organizations, post notifications that video recording remains in place. If staff have access to electronic cameras on their phones, define who can review footage, for what function, and how long clips can be kept before deletion.
Timekeeping and export integrity matter if video footage might support legal action. Keep system clocks synced through a reputable NTP source. When exporting, consist of the gamer software if the format is exclusive, and maintain hash values where supplied. Label clips with event numbers, not just dates, and store them in a different, backed-up area. These small practices avoid disputes over authenticity.
I have actually seen the very same five failure modes on repeat. Video cameras pointed into direct daybreak or sunset will blind themselves for a piece of every day. IR showing off siding will mist an image all night. Auto bitrates on hectic scenes overload NVRs and drop feeds. Consumer routers with UPnP expose devices on the general public internet, and bots try default passwords within hours. And finally, someone pulls a cable tight without a drip loop, rain gets in the wall, and the electronic camera passes away a week later.
Recovery starts with seclusion. Check power at the PoE port and at the electronic camera. Swap a known-good cable television or switch port. Streamline the network course. If night images are bad, hold a white card in front of the lens to view how the IR responds. If motion alerts blow up your phone, reduce sensitivity during wind gusts or use analytic rules with things filters rather of pixel movement. Keep a little set on hand: extra PoE injector, brief spot cables, a multimeter, a PoE tester, and a spare cam. The fastest fix is often replacement, followed by a bench diagnosis later.
Costs differ extensively. A fundamental four-camera wired IP kit with a good NVR and 2 TB of storage can land in between 500 and 1,200 dollars, depending upon sensor quality and functions. Adding professional labor and correct cabling frequently doubles that, with material choices and building complexity driving variance. Wireless setups may save on labor but can cost more in continuous batteries, subscription cloud storage, and occasional troubleshooting.
Spend where it moves the needle. Excellent lenses and trustworthy recording beat fancy features. Purchase a couple of higher-spec cams for recognition and fill in protection with mid-tier designs. Do not low-cost out on switches and cable television. If cloud gain access to is a must, pay for a vendor with a track record and a clear security design. Free communities feature strings that yank later.
Wired IP systems: stable, scalable, PoE streamlines power and data, best for irreversible setups and critical coverage.
Wireless security electronic cameras: fast to deploy, flexible, constrained by power and radio environment, perfect for short-lived or hard-to-wire spots.
Hybrid: most typical in real websites, wire the core, go wireless at the edges, keep a consistent management user interface if possible.
This decision is less about ideology and more about the structure, the ground, and the dangers. A ranch-style home with open attic runs begs for Cat6. A concrete mid-rise condominium says wireless and persistence. A little storage facility with a clear main aisle states PoE and fixed turrets at 8 to twelve feet.
The first week with a new system is the most essential. You will discover which electronic cameras chatter with incorrect positives and which ones stay silent when they should not. Modify sensitivity at different times of day. Produce schedules. Tag important clips so you can train your own expectations and, if your system supports it, train analytics. Do a monthly five-minute audit: live view each cam, scrub the last 24 hours on fast speed, and export one clip to validate the workflow still works. Replace desiccant packs in domes as needed, wipe lenses, and tighten up mounts after seasonal storms.
When something feels off, it normally is. A cam that starts flickering at sunset may have a failing IR variety. A feed that drops whenever the microwave runs means your cordless channel option is poor. A system that keeps missing out on faces at the door needs a slightly lower install or a narrower lens. Little modifications build up into genuine performance.
Choosing and setting up the ideal security camera system is not about the flashiest spec sheet. It has to do with matching capability to reality, then showing it with light, angles, and practices. Whether you lean on expert cctv installation services or construct it yourself, treat the process like any craft. Strategy thoroughly, set up cleanly, test honestly, and file enough that your future self can fix what breaks. If you do that, the footage you require will exist, and it will be clear enough to matter.
